It took about an hour and 15 minutes to get to the hotel from the airport but they gave us a drink and a man come round and give you an all inclusive band. You get given tickets to put on your suitcases so that they are delivered to your room.

The reception was very nice.

The room we stayed in had a double bed then two single beds and a cot. Cot not very safe. Rooms were a bit dated but fairly clean apart from the ants nest outside. The complex is big.

The main restaurant offers a great choice for breakfast, lunch and dinner and they have different themed nights. There are four restaurants and you are able to go to 3 in a week. Mexican and Seafood were the best. Italian was poor and Mediterrnean was the worst. There is a snack bar located on the beach. There was a good selection of drinks at bars.

There is a street outside which has about 10 shops, cybercafe, a disco, casino, burger place, karaoke bar and hard rock cafe. They open at 11:30pm till 2:30pm. The beach was ok, nice warm water, a variety of watersports including jet skis, bannana boat, scuba diving, pedalos. Non-motorised are in with the all inclusive.

The best thing about the hotel is the entertainment and animation team. There was activities from 10am such as aerobics, water aerobics, Spanish lessons, darts, french bowls, crazy ball games, crazy games. Thursday was football, mini golf, volleyball and tennis tournments. Friday they had a mini olympics. The team that won usualy won a t-shirt or certificate. They had a kids club as well which did different activities. At night there was a kids disco at half 8 and they had a game for the kids then they had an icebreaker game for the adults. Then there was a show or some sort usually dancing. The comedy show, playback show and magic show were good. The animation team work really hard but they are good fun and they love their job.

Beware of the sandflies their is loads of them and everyone in the hotel gets bitten a lot of people had about 70 bites all over their legs. I was lucky and got about 10.

It is also very hard to get a signal on your phone, you are able to get an Orange signal if you go to the beach even if your not on Orange. I would go to this hotel again but not just yet because I like to go to different places.

The hotel complex was fairly large and had a wide range of facilites. There were lots of bars, a few pools, loads of sun loungers around the pool and along the beach, you could hire out pedalo's, wind surfers, kayak's, boogie boards and snorkels and for a fee go out on a banana boat or scuba dive.

There were quite a few restraunts to choose from with the main one being a buffet style restraunt with a good range to suit all tastes and chef's who would cook dishes for you on the spot e.g omlettes in the morning with your choice of filling or pasta dishes in the evening. There were 3 a la carte restraunts which need to be booked a night in advance, the mexican was okay, the italian was very nice and the mediteranean was superb. There was also a fish restraunt which was for the club hacienda and principe gold customers only. There were also two fast food type restraunts which were very good which served burgers, hot dogs, pizza, fried chicked etc with chips and salad from 10am in the morning right through to 4am the next morning.
